Boise's climate presents specific storage challenges. Our hot, dry summers are great for boating, but intense UV rays can damage boat interiors and fade gel coats. Conversely, our winters, while relatively mild compared to other parts of Idaho, can still bring freezing temperatures and occasional snow. This makes finding storage that offers protection from both sun and cold a top priority. Many public storage facilities in the Meridian, Eagle, and Garden City areas now offer covered or fully enclosed units, which are highly recommended for year-round protection.
When evaluating public boat storage near Boise, consider more than just price. Look for facilities with features like 24/7 security access, gated entry, and good lighting. Proximity to major roadways like I-84 or State Highway 21 is also a huge plus for easy trips to Lucky Peak. Don't forget to measure your boat, trailer, and motor carefully—including the tongue of the trailer—to ensure you rent a space that's truly adequate. A facility with wide driveways and easy maneuvering room will save you countless headaches.
For many local boaters, the decision between indoor, covered, or outdoor storage comes down to usage and budget. If you use your boat frequently throughout the summer, a covered space at a facility near the reservoir might offer the best balance of protection and accessibility. For winter lay-ups, especially if you don't winterize for occasional mild-weather use, an indoor, climate-controlled unit in the valley can prevent freeze damage and keep your boat ready for an unexpected sunny January day.
